  Changed windows font...
Posted by: MaBo - 2004-05-13, 08:12 AM - Forum: GB-PVR Support (legacy) - No Replies

Hi,

As for the moment I don't have a monitor attached to my htpc, I'm using the TV as a monitor. For that to work, I increased the windows font size. However, now some gbpvr things (via both the pvr tv-out and the video card tv-out) use the larger font, some others don't. For instance the top buttons on the main menu are still the way they used to be, the lower ones (from plugins and custom tasks) use the larger fonts. Also the OSD and the recordings sub-menu use the larger font. This makes it better to read, however no two lines fit in the box for one recording. Also on the OSD the time display is out of alignment.

I must say the larger fonts increase readability, but the way it looks now is less apealing.

I use the red-sky skin and like it VERY much. I changed two things:
1. Decrease the vertical button spacing from 40 to 35 to accomodate more buttons.
2. Change the redish font color into grey. Red font on red background was sometimes hard to read.

BTW my eyes are in excellent order ;-)
